Call screening, glare and cartoons for inkscape
April 13
In continuity with the previous post I share these packs of filters that are produced by the same author but had overlooked. It includes a collection specifically for glare or lighting effects and a collection for flames, smoke and particles, personally I love these.
To use, you must import the svg file in our work area, then select the object to which you want to filter. Go to the top menu of filters and filter editor finally there appear and can be activated with the checks you want.

Package inkscape surface filters
April 12

As is known inkscape strong feature is the manipulation of vectors and not really handling bits or texture maps. But one can always do another trick to achieve effects of texture and relief in our vectors.
Inkscape has a number of predefined filters that allow us to create different textures, there are some who are great but other than the truth I have no idea who would use
However, in reality there is freedom to add new ones.
This filter package is created by irzun.deviantart.com and truth that are most that can be very useful, possibly create a tutorial for creating a graphic with textures created from these filters.
They can be downloaded at the following link.
The author explains that to Inkscape 0.47 version of the installation steps is to copy and paste the contents of the downloaded file into "Inkscape / share / filters".
I use version 0.48 and I found a folder "Inkscape" or. "Inkscape" in my home so I had to paste the contents in "/ usr / share / inkscape / filters /", note that to paste this content folder requires root permissions. If you're running Ubuntu in a terminal "sudo nautilus" to open a file browser with root permissions, it would help a lot. ![]()
UPDATE: Gez tells us that the configuration files in the folder inkscape, are in .config / inkscape from 0.48. Thanks for the input
Finally there is only open inkscape -> create any shape and select -> go to Filter menu -> Surface -> Choose the one you want.
